What is a Bedside Cot?
A bedside cot, likewise referred to as a co-sleeper or side sleeper, is a kind of crib that is created to attach safely to the side of the moms and dad's bed. It permits easy access to the baby throughout the night while supplying a different sleeping space. This design supports safe sleep practices while assisting in nighttime feeding and comforting.

Promotes Safe Sleep
Bedside cots abide by safe sleep standards as the infant has its own sleeping space. This separation decreases the threat of suffocation and getting too hot, which prevail concerns with standard co-sleeping arrangements.
2. Boosts Bonding
Having a bedside cot permits parents to react rapidly to their baby's needs throughout the night. This distance can strengthen the parent-child bond and encourage an emotional connection.
3. Helps With Nighttime Feeding
For breastfeeding mothers, bedside cots present the perfect service for nighttime feedings without the need to fully get up or get out of bed.
4. Reduces Stress
The close range enables parents to feel more at ease, knowing they can examine their baby without rising. This plan can result in a more peaceful sleep for both the moms and dad and the kid.
5. Versatile Use
Numerous bedside cots can transform into standalone cribs, making them a long-term financial investment in your child's sleeping arrangements. They can often be utilized up until the child is around 6-12 months old, depending on the specific design.
Considerations When Choosing a Bedside Cot
When purchasing a bedside cot, it is important to think about different factors:
1. Security Standards
Make sure that the cot complies with regional safety regulations. Search for brand names that have been tested and certified for safety.
2. Mattress Quality
The quality of the mattress is essential for the health and comfort of the baby. A company, helpful bed mattress is required to prevent concerns such as SIDS (Sudden Infant Death Syndrome).
3. Budget
Bedside cots can be found in a range of prices. Set a budget and think about the best value for the functions you require.
4. Size and Space
Make certain to inspect the dimensions of the cot and guarantee that it fits well next to your bed. If space is a concern, go with a model that is easily portable or collapsible.
5. Ease of Assembly
Some cots are more complicated to put together than others. Look for designs that are user-friendly, particularly if you anticipate moving the Cot With Drawer more than when.

Are bedside cots safe for newborns?
Yes, bedside cots are developed to provide a safe sleeping environment for newborns, offered they meet security requirements and are set up properly.
2. At what age can my baby transition from a bedside cot?
Usually, babies can use bedside cots till they are about 6-12 months old or until they can pull themselves up or roll over. Always refer to the maker's guidelines.
3. Can bedside cots be utilized for traveling?
Lots of bedside cots are portable and foldable, making them appropriate for travel. However, ensure that the specific design you pick is developed for easy transport.
4. How do I make sure the bedside cot is protected to my bed?
Follow the maker's guidelines carefully for connecting the cot to your bed. The majority of models have systems to secure them firmly.
5. Can I use a routine crib instead of a bedside cot?
While a regular crib uses a safe sleeping space, it does not supply the exact same benefit for nighttime access and bonding that bedside cots do.
